How they compare
South Africa currently reports 4.7% against 4.6% in Croatia, a difference of 0.1%.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 5 shared years of data; in 2017 it was South Africa ahead.
Croatia ranks 67th and South Africa ranks 64th of 108 countries.
Across the 2 decades both report, Croatia averaged higher in 1 and South Africa in 1.
